St. George vs Hurricane: The First Big Decision
Before diving into neighborhoods, you need to understand the two core living styles.
St. George Living
Best for:
Convenience
Shopping + restaurants
Golf communities
Established neighborhoods
Feels like:
A growing city with strong amenities
Hurricane / Sand Hollow Living
Best for:
Outdoor lifestyle
More space
Adventure access
Faster growth
Feels like:
Open desert + lifestyle-driven living

Top Neighborhoods in St. George Utah
Entrada at Snow Canyon (Luxury Living)
If you want:
High-end desert luxury
Entrada offers:
- Private gated community
- Red rock views
- Championship golf
- Resort-style living
Price range:
$800K – $3M+
Desert Color (Vacation + Investment Hotspot)
This is one of the fastest-growing communities.
Why buyers love it:
- Lagoon-style water feature
- Vacation rental approved
- New construction
- Strong rental demand
Best for:
- Investors
- Second homes
- Vacation buyers
Little Valley / Washington Fields (Family Living)
If you want:
Space + family-friendly living
This is one of the most desirable areas for:
- Schools
- Parks
- Larger homes
Top Neighborhoods Near Sand Hollow & Hurricane
Sand Hollow Resort (Lifestyle + Views)
This is one of the most unique places in Southern Utah.
You get:
- Golf course living
- Reservoir views
- Red rock landscape
- Close access to dunes
Best for:
- Lifestyle buyers
- Second homes
- Luxury buyers
Dixie Springs (Adventure Access)
This is where things get fun.
Known for:
- UTV access
- Larger lots
- No HOA (in many areas)
You can ride directly from your house to the dunes.
Copper Rock (Fast-Growing Golf Community)
New, modern, and growing fast.
Offers:
- Golf course homes
- Clean layouts
- Investment potential

The Hidden Factors You NEED to Know
Before buying, you should understand:
1. HOA vs No HOA
Some areas:
Strict rules
Others:
Full freedom
2. Nightly Rental Zones
Some areas:
Allow Airbnb
Others:
Do not
3. Distance to Activities
5 minutes vs 20 minutes matters MORE than you think.
